What is the required amount of the contractor's license bond for an active California contractor's license?
a.$12,500
b.$15,000
c.$100,000
d.$25,000
Explicación
Under B&P Code section 7071.6, an active contractor's license must be secured by a $25,000 contractor's license bond filed with the Registrar. This bond protects consumers and specified others harmed by the contractor's violations.
Referencia Legal: B&P Code §7071.6Practica las 1605 preguntas gratis — sin registro.
